Why doesn't PEPE reach $1? This is why, my friend, for PEPE to reach $1, its market capitalization must exceed BTC's market capitalization. Yes, this is what should happen. That's why I told you that it is very difficult to reach this price. How is this done in order to determine the price that can be achieved? In order for the currency to reach it, you must first calculate the market value of this currency. Let's do this together. First, the market value is multiplying the number of the coin x its price. The number of tokens is 420 trillion x their current price of 0.000005. We get $3 billion, and if we multiply the number of Pepe coins x $1, it will be its market value. 420 trillion dollars, while the market value of Bitcoin is now 1.3 trillion dollars, meaning that in order for the value of Bibi to become $1, its market value must be 420 times greater than the value of Bitcoin, and this is impossible to happen, so do not be fooled by lies and do research Your account before entering into any currency.
